Paige Spiranac Reveals Her One ’18+ Only’ Golf Tip. It’s Not What You Think.


LOS ANGELES, CA – Golf influencer and podcast host Paige Spiranac sent the internet into a frenzy this week after teasing an “18+ only” golf tip on her various social media channels. The post, which featured her signature blend of humor and intrigue, quickly went viral, with speculation running wild about the nature of the mature-rated advice.

The caption, simply stating, “You have to be 18 years or older for this one,” was enough to generate thousands of comments guessing everything from a risqué mental game strategy to a technically complex driver swing secret.

However, in a classic bait-and-switch that has become a hallmark of her brand, Spiranac used her popular podcast, “Playing A Round with Paige Renee,” to reveal the tip, and it had nothing to do with anatomy or innuendo. The “18+ only” requirement was about maturity and mindset, not titillation.

So, what was the controversial tip?

Stop caring what other people think.

“My one tip, and honestly the most important one for any golfer, is to stop letting the opinion of others dictate your game and your enjoyment,” Spiranac explained to her listeners. “But that’s an adult concept. It takes real maturity to block out that external noise—whether it’s a critical playing partner, someone judging you on the range, or the comments section online. You have to be 18 or older not in age, but in mindset, to truly grasp it and implement it.”

The simple yet profound advice resonated deeply with her audience, though it was not what many were initially expecting.

“I saw the headline and my mind went straight to the gutter, I’ll admit it,” said one fan on Twitter. “But she got me. And honestly, it’s the best golf advice I’ve heard in years. It’s so true.”

The stunt is a masterclass in modern content creation and a testament to Spiranac’s unique position in the golf world. She expertly leverages the curiosity that surrounds her persona to deliver genuinely valuable content, all while poking fun at the stereotypes and perceptions she often faces.

“People are always expecting something provocative from me,” she said with a laugh during the podcast episode. “And sometimes I like to play into that, but always with a purpose. This time, the purpose was to talk about the mental game. The pressure to perform, the fear of judgment—it’s the number one thing holding amateur golfers back. Conquering that is a grown-up skill.”

The reaction has been overwhelmingly positive, with coaches and mental game experts praising the message. Dr. Alan Richardson, a sports psychologist, commented, “What Paige is talking about is foundational. Performance anxiety and social scrutiny are massive barriers. Framing it as an ‘adult’ concept is a brilliant way to get golfers to take it seriously.”

In the end, the “18+ only” headline did exactly what it was designed to do: it grabbed attention. But instead of leading to something salacious, it led to a powerful lesson in confidence and self-assurance—proving once again that Paige Spiranac is far more than a clickbait headline. She’s a savvy businesswoman who knows how to drive a message home.
